I got the front air dam on my C300 caught on a spike on one of those concrete parking curbs. The snow plow had yanked the curb from the ground and when it settled back, the spike was sticking out about an inch. I didn't see it and pull in a bit too far. The air dam flexed and went over the spike with no problem, but then I couldn't back off it. I had to bring out two reams of copier paper from the office and jam them under the front tire. That gave me the clearance I needed to back up over the spike. After that I started backing into spaces.

I lowered my gf's GTI and missed the part about there being a bolt inside the wheel well (for the liner) to remove when lowering past a certain point. I've never scraped lip on a dip in the road, but I have hit one that caused the car to compress enough to smack that bolt that punched a crease into her fender from the inside out
